Key Verse: 28:15

First, God's vision to Jacob (1-17). Isaac gave Jacob the direction to go to Haran and marry one of Laban's daughters. Also, Isaac blessed Jacob with the covenant promise given to Abraham and Isaac. During Jacob's first night alone, the Lord appeared to Jacob in a vision with angels descending and ascending on a stairway to heaven. Then God extended his promise to give Jacob the land, to give him countless descendants, and to bless all people on earth through him. Practically, God guaranteed to protect Jacob and bring him home safely. God knew Jacob's selfishness, yet the Lord embraced him, shepherded him, and protected him when he was most vulnerable.

Second, Jacob's vow (18-22). In the morning, Jacob erected a pillar and made a vow that if God provided for him, protected him and brought him back, God would be his God. He would worship God and offer him a tithe. This selfish vow began Jacob's walk with God, and God would use it as his hook to capture Jacob's heart.
